Компания VMware закончила разработку новой версии решения для виртуализации настольных ПК предприятия VMware View 4.5, которое позволяет разместить рабочие станции пользователей на серверах виртуализации, добившись существенной экономии на содержание парка настольных компьютеров, а также повысить управляемость и безопасность данной части инфраструктуры.
Вот основной список новых функций VMware View 4.5:
View Client with Local Mode - это возможность выгрузить виртуальный ПК из датацентра компании и использовать его "офф-лайн" на своем ноутбуке. Полезная возможность для мобильных пользователей, пребывающих в местах без интернета. Как мы и обещали - клиентского гипервизора нет.
Full Windows 7 support - полная поддержка ОС Windows 7 для использования в виртуальных ПК.
View Client for Mac OS X - можно управлять своим виртуальным ПК с компьютера с Apple Mac OS.
Integrated Application Assignment - возможность доставки виртуализованных с помощью ThinApp приложений с использованием консоли View Administrator.
Rich Graphical Dashboards - удобный и переработанный интерфейс (на базе Adobe Flex) и более понятное логирование событий, а также диагностика компонентов решения.
Role Based Administration - администрирование через View Manager на базе ролей.
Integration with Microsoft SCOM and PowerShell - интеграция VMware View с существующей инфраструктурой Microsoft System Center Operations Manager (SCOM) и средствами автоматизации PowerShell для виртуальных ПК.
Increased scalability - Возможность размещения еще большего количества виртуальных ПК в инфраструктуре датацентра.
Tiered storage support - отличная возможность управлять хранением данных различного типа на хранилищах (datastores) разной категории (в плане производительности).
Lowest Cost Reference Architectures - VMware поработала с партнерами (Dell, HP, Cisco, NetApp и EMC), чтобы разработать эффективные по стоимости и производительности референсные архитектуры для потенциальных клиентов.
Еще улучшения:
Virtual Profiles - это профили пользователей виртуальных ПК на базе программного продукта от компании RPO Software, приобретенного VMware. Эта возможность позволяет "отвязать" профиль пользователя от операционной системы Windows, что значительно повысит гибкость решения. - Не успели сделать еще.
Full Sysprep support - поддержка механизма автоматизированного развертывания Sysprep.
Snapshot support for Linked Clones - так называемый "плавающий" пул (Floating Pool).
Kiosk Mode Desktop Pools - конфигурация десктопов на уровне устройств.
Web Download Portal - возможность скачивания клиентского ПО через Web.
Детальное описание некоторых возможностей:
Администрирование на базе ролей в VMware View 4.5
Одной из новых возможностей VMware View 4.5 является администрирование инфраструктуры виртуальных ПК на базе ролевой модели.
Это позволяет использовать решение в крупных предприятиях, где есть различные ИТ-отделы (например, поддержка пользователей виртуальных ПК). Ранее была только одна роль VMware View 4 - Administrator, которая позволяла изменять абсолютно все настройки продукта. Теперь появилось несколько ролей:
Administrators
Administrators (Read Only)
Agent Registration Administrators
Global Configuration and Policy Administrators
Global Configuration and Policy Administrators (Read Only)
Inventory Administrators
Inventory Administrators (Read Only)
Кроме данных предопределенных ролей можно создать собственную роль с определенным набором привилегий (например, добавление новых ПК или управление пользователями). Набор привилегий достаточно обширен (обратите внимание на полосу прокрутки):
Также в VMware View 4.5 можно создавать папки-контейнеры для различных объектов и на эти папки вешать разрешения для различных групп пользователей (можно разделять по отделам, городам и т.п.):
Одной из новых возможностей решения для виртуализаци настольных ПК VMware View 4.5 стала возможность организации ярусного хранения данных виртуальных машин (Tiered Storage), где для различных типов данных в зависимости от требований к производительности можно использовать различные типы устройств хранения.
Мы уже писали о средстве VMware View Composer, которое позволяет использовать связанные клоны (Linked Clones) в целях экономии дискового пространства. Composer использует один базовый образ виртуального ПК на основе которого развертываются новые унифицированные виртуальные ПК с данными пользователей.
Напомним некоторые понятия хранения данных виртуальных ПК:
Master Replica – это основной образ виртуального ПК с установленной гостевой ОС и приложениями, хранимый как шаблон.
Replica – это клон Master Replica на базе дисков растущих по мере наполнения (Thin Provisioned). Он создается для каждого нового пула виртуальных ПК на своем datastore. Этот образ используется для создания новых десктопов-связанных клонов, которые зависят только от Replica, что позволяет вносить изменения в Master Replica, не затрагивая дочерние виртуальные машины пула.
Linked Clone – это связанный клон на базе реплики, который представляет собой совокупность: Измененные данные реплики (Delta Footprint) + Журнал (Log) + Диск с пользовательскими данными (User Data Disk)
В VMware View 4.5 появились новые типы дисков:
Persistent Disk – это и есть старый User Data Disk, который теперь носит такое название. Можно хранить persistent disk внутри диска гостевой ОС либо на отдельном vmdk.
Disposable Disk – это отдельный диск для хранения файлов подкачки гостевой ОС и временных файлов. View Manager удаляет эти файлы после выключения связанного клона. Этот тип диска позволяет замедлить рост данных, занимаемых виртуальным ПК.
Теперь Linked Clone представляет собой следующую комбинацию:
Измененные данные реплики (Delta Footprint) + Журнал (Log) + Диск с пользовательскими данными (Persistent Disk) + Временный диск (Disposable Disk)
Для чего это сделано? Очевидно, что эти типы данных, из которых состоит виртуальная машина требуют различного быстродействия, что ведет за собой хранение этих объектов на разных типах носителей.
Через View Administrator можно выбрать различные Datastores для описанных выше объектов, которые могут размещаться на флеш-носителях SSD (самые быстрые), Fibre Channel (помедленнее) и SATA (самые медленные). Само собой, чем быстрее носитель - тем он дороже, поэтому, например, реплику (которая одна для всего пула и всеми машинами используется) можно размещать на SSD.
А вот пользовательские диски можно размещать и на носителях SATA. Картина в целом такова: